WebWhat are the Bremerhaven to Berlin train times and schedule? If you're travelling on a weekday, you'll find the earliest train to Berlin leaving Bremerhaven at around 05:28 and the last train leaving at around 23:03. At weekends, the first train of the day leaves Bremerhaven at around 04:12, with the final departure at 00:13. WebJun 11, 2024 · Car. German roads are excellent and driving around the country can be a lot of fun. The country’s pride and joy is its 6800-mile (11,000km) network of autobahns (freeways). About every 30 miles, you’ll find elaborate service areas with gas stations, bathrooms and restaurants, and many are open 24 hours. WebGermany’s so-called ‘Romantic Road’ is a popular tourist magnet in the southern provinces of Baden-Wurttemberg and Bavaria. It’s loosely based on an old Roman route, and it includes visits to several enchanting walled towns, historic cities, and awesome castles. WebThere are excellent cheap train tickets called Sparpreis or ‘Saver’ fares on international rail services to and from Germany. Sparpreis fares are also available on DB’s international coach services run under the IC-Bus brand.
